Mary Lou Jones and Steven Swartz spent six winters between 1977 and 1982 exploring and learning about Laguna San Iganacio, its gray whales, wildlife, and the community of people that called this unique marine environment their home. Their initial surveys and descriptions of the lagoon and its use by gray whales were instrumental in the development of regulations and guidelines to conserve this marine protect area as a winter breeding ground for gray whales, and for sustainable ecotourism in the future. With its comprehensive descriptions of gray whale behavior and biology, its overview of the history and wildlife of this unique marine reserve, this book is the ideal visitor's guide to the exploration of the wonders of Laguna San Ignacio.
